Members Networking  Meeting with Speaker Liz Godsell of Godsells Cheese

Liz has lived and worked on a dairy farm in Leonard Stanley, Gloucestershire all her life.  Loving both cows and cheese, both are essential to her on a daily basis!

Liz and husband Bryan along with seven part time local ladies and gents are the team that makes up Godsells Cheese.   They started making cheese in 2001 just as Foot & Mouth broke out.  And after 21 years of making artisan cheese, they have almost perfected their product which includes Traditional hard cheeses, Double Gloucester, Single Gloucester, and Leonard Stanley Cheddar.  The way these cheeses are produced is quite innovative so that they have never had to throw a batch of cheese away, instead they just create a new cheese if something goes wrong!

They are part of "Free Range" milk, trying to add value to the milk that they produce upholding their ethos that cows should graze grass. Godsells' promise is that their cows should graze for a minimum of 180 days each year.

In addition they have added a vending machine to our activities selling Farm Fresh pasteurised, non homogenised milk at the farm gate along with their amazing cheeses, and open 24/7 !
